Kodal Overcomes Major Permit Challenge for Mali Lithium Mine Expansion!

Kodal Minerals has achieved a significant milestone in its plans for the development of a lithium mine in Mali, as the company recently cleared a crucial permit hurdle that paves the way for advancing its project. This development comes at a time when global demand for lithium,essential for electric vehicle batteries and renewable energy storage,is surging. The Mali lithium mine, located in the prolific Bougouni region, promises to bolster the region’s economic landscape while contributing to the growing need for lasting energy solutions. With this key permit now in place, Kodal Minerals is poised to move forward, aiming to enhance lithium production and establish itself as a significant player in the booming lithium market.

Kodal Achieves Milestone in Mali Lithium Project with Critical Permit Approval

Kodal Minerals has marked a significant advancement in its Mali Lithium Project by securing a crucial permit that paves the way for the development of what could be one of West Africa’s key lithium mines. The approval of this critical permit is a testament to the company’s commitment to the project and its strategic importance in the growing global demand for lithium, a vital component in electric vehicle batteries and renewable energy solutions. Industry experts have noted that this milestone will streamline the operational processes and provide a clearer pathway towards full-scale mining operations, thus enhancing the investment attractiveness of the region.

With the permit now in place, Kodal is set to focus on the next phase of its project development, which includes finalizing resource estimates and commencing the necessary infrastructure preparations. The company is keen on engaging with local stakeholders to ensure a sustainable approach to mining that benefits both the habitat and the surrounding communities. Key highlights surrounding the permit approval include:

  • Accelerated project Timeline: the approval enables an expedited timeline towards actual mining operations.
  • Local Employment Opportunities: The project is expected to create jobs and stimulate local economies.
  • Focus on Sustainability: Kodal emphasizes environmentally responsible practices in its mining processes.
